Understanding Cross-Chain Interoperability

Cross-chain interoperability in wallets is essential for efficient digital asset management. Imagine you’re at a currency exchange booth, and you want to swap your dollars for euros. If the booth can only exchange dollars for yen, your options become limited, making the process cumbersome. Similarly, a blockchain wallet that supports multiple cryptocurrencies across different platforms enhances user experience significantly. By integrating these functionalities, wallets can offer seamless transactions across diverse blockchain networks.

The Role of Zero-Knowledge Proofs in UX Design

Zero-knowledge proofs (ZKPs) allow users to prove they possess certain information without revealing the information itself. Think of it like showing you have a ticket to a concert without actually showing the ticket. This feature can bolster security while simplifying user interactions. In 2025, implementing ZKPs in wallet design can provide users with peace of mind, knowing their sensitive data remains confidential while enjoying seamless transactions.

User-Centric Design: Making Wallets Intuitive

When designing blockchain wallets, prioritizing user-centric approaches is vital. Visualize a grocery store: if the layout is confusing, shoppers won’t find what they want and may leave frustrated. Similarly, an intuitive wallet interface helps users navigate transactions and manage assets effortlessly. Key aspects such as simplifying navigation and incorporating educational resources will guide users effectively, reducing errors and enhancing satisfaction.

Safety Features: Enhancing Trust in Blockchain Wallets

Safety features are paramount for building trust in blockchain wallets. Just as you would secure your home with locks and alarms, users need confidence in their wallet’s security. Implementing robust features like two-factor authentication (2FA) and backup options can mitigate risks significantly.
